Telvin Sowah, a Ghanaian prophet, has warned the Black Stars technical team from changing goalkeeper Benjamin Asare from the World Cup squad.

The prophet noted that, since Benjamin Asare joined the Black Stars, he has contributed significantly.

According to the man of God, Benjamin Asare, the spirit of Black Stars team must not be dropped, else the team will lose all group matches at the 2026 World Cup.

Speaking in an interview with Accra FM, Prophet Telvin warned, “If they change the goalkeeper, they’ve killed everything. They should maintain the local one. That’s why I urge them to use local players. Since he joined, there’s been calm in the team. He is the spirit of the team, so he should be maintained. If they go shopping and replace him, I’ll reveal how we’ll perform.

“We will lose the first, second, and third matches. Even the weakest team will beat us. There will be just one great team in their group, and they’ll defeat them easily. If they don’t respect the timing, they can forget it,” the prophet cautioned.

Meanwhile, Dr Ernest Koranteng, Chief Executive of The BAC Group, has called out the Ghana Football Association, Kurt Okraku.

According to Dr Ernest Koranteng, the GFA President’s reference to players as ‘mercenaries’ was an unfortunate choice of words.

He is quoted by TV3 to have saying, “GFA President calling players mercenaries is unfortunate”.

His remarks follow an interview in which the GFA president  Kurt Okraku referred to some players as mercenaries for rejecting playing for the Black Stars.

According to the GFA president, the Black Stars only need committed and passionate players ahead of the 2026 FIFA World Cup in the United States, Canada and Mexico.

Speaking in an interview with 3 sports, Kurt Okraku stated, “Players who have not shown enough commitment to the Ghanaian flag will not be part of us. There must be a good reason why a player is included in the travelling party. I want players who display high levels of dedication, passion, and respect for Ghana.”

“As a leader, I don’t really care what anybody says. At the end of the day, the responsibility lies with me, and I am accountable for Ghana.”

He added, “If we have approached you before and you turned us down, if you’ve shown a lack of respect or declined to play for Ghana in the past, count yourself out. It’s not going to happen”.

His comments come following reports of Eddie Nketiah, Callum Hudson-Odoi, and Francis Amuzu wanting to play for the Black Stars at the World Cup after years of rejecting Ghana.

Meanwhile, Saddick Adams, a veteran sports journalist, has revealed that Eddie Nketiah, an English player of Ghanaian descent, is open to playing for the Black Stars.

According to Saddick Adams, Eddie Nketiah had, some years ago, rejected Ghana’s approach when officials from the Ghana Football Association (GFA) approached him.

The Angel FM presenter added that the Crystal Palace striker now feels mature and is ready to play for the national team if given a call-up.

Saddick Adams, in a post on X, wrote, “Spoke to Eddie Nketiah’s family this weekend to get clarity on the stories about his switch.

The source admitted that Eddie Nketiah had previously spoken to the Ghana coach and some GFA top officials, but he had not settled at his club yet, so he couldn’t make a decision”.

He added, “However, Nketiah is now settled and at 26, mature enough and ready to ‘give his very best’ if Ghana calls now.

Says he has Ghana blood running through him, so his “identity is unquestionable”.

Basically, he’s open to playing for Ghana now”.
